Output 42160101abbef913a5bca3165f03d9a3ee419bbbefd70c4d9b16a3be38be4dce:0

value
17196
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b77ec706cad34fce4bd0844f51a0f6212917c2da97a03f7de65e793dfec8728e
address
bc1pkalvwpk26d8uuj7ss384rg8kyy530sk6j7sr7l0xteunmlkgw28qdsz7q7
transaction
42160101abbef913a5bca3165f03d9a3ee419bbbefd70c4d9b16a3be38be4dce
confirmations
108420
spent
true